Whats a good size pot to max these girls out under a 5x5 1000 watt cool tube setup? I've got 6.5gallons tops atm
Open
Other. Other
1 like
Answer
HeavyHittah
HeavyHittahanswered grow question a year ago
You'd burn the shit out of them with a 1000 watt hps. Autos' light period is longer than photoperiods so you have to be careful with your DLI if not supplementing with CO2. At a guess you would only need a 400/500watt hps in that space . So be careful not to overdo it. Also Fastbuds recommend the max pot size is 20 litres for autos. As they only really veg for 35 to 40 days. So there is limited time for it to establish a bigger root mass in a larger pot.

1 gallon per month / 1 gallon per foot of height... general suggestions. you can get away with less in soilless with chelated hydro nutes (not soil nutes) if doing any 'special' irrigation method like multiple fertigations per day, you need to think about it differently. some familiarity will be needed to know how big your plants tend to get and how quickly they can drink

24 hour soak and dropped em in some 6 gallon pot. The soil is made up of the leftover mix from lst years pots. My autoflower mix is Basically: Sunshine mix #4 (1:3) Perlite/vermiculite mix (1:3) Lobster compost (1:3) And a few tablespoons of bone meal. Most times I'll also add worm castings,blood meal and hardwood ashes but I'm broke so I'll wait till I can afford it and make a tea.
